ios5 By Tutorials
根据提供的文件信息,我们可以归纳出一系列与iOS 5开发相关的知识点。这本教程由Ray Wenderlich和他的团队编写,涵盖了从基础知识到高级技术的各种主题。接下来将详细介绍这些章节中的核心概念和技术要点。 ### 一、简介(Chapter 1: Introduction) - **iOS 5概述**:介绍了iOS 5的基本特性及其在移动应用开发领域的重要性。 - **本书结构**:解释了本书的整体结构以及每个章节的大致内容。 - **目标读者**:明确了本书的目标读者群体,包括初学者和有一定经验的开发者。 ### 二、自动引用计数(ARC)基础(Chapter 2: Beginning ARC) - **ARC的概念**:解释了ARC的工作原理以及如何利用它简化内存管理。 - **ARC基本用法**:演示了如何在代码中使用ARC来自动管理对象的生命周期。 - **常见陷阱**:讨论了使用ARC时可能遇到的问题,并提供了解决方案。 ### 三、中级自动引用计数(ARC)(Chapter 3: Intermediate ARC) - **高级ARC技术**:介绍了更复杂的ARC使用场景,如弱引用和无捕获规则等。 - **性能优化**:探讨了如何通过合理的ARC使用来提高应用程序的性能。 - **错误排查**:讲解了如何诊断和修复ARC相关的问题。 ### 四、故事板基础(Chapter 4: Beginning Storyboards) - **故事板介绍**:解释了故事板的作用以及如何使用它们构建用户界面。 - **基本组件**:介绍了故事板中常见的界面元素及其使用方法。 - **导航与过渡**:演示了如何设置屏幕间的导航逻辑和过渡动画。 ### 五、中级故事板(Chapter 5: Intermediate Storyboards) - **复杂布局**:展示了如何使用故事板创建复杂的用户界面布局。 - **自定义视图控制器**:讲解了如何在故事板中嵌入自定义视图控制器。 - **动态加载**:介绍了如何动态加载和管理故事板中的视图。 ### 六、iCloud基础(Chapter 6: Beginning iCloud) - **iCloud概览**:概述了iCloud的服务及其对iOS应用的意义。 - **集成步骤**:详细说明了如何将iCloud功能集成到iOS应用中。 - **数据同步**:讲解了如何实现跨设备的数据同步。 ### 七、中级iCloud(Chapter 7: Intermediate iCloud) - **高级特性**:介绍了iCloud的一些高级功能,如文件存储和文档共享。 - **安全性和隐私**:讨论了如何确保iCloud数据的安全性和用户的隐私。 - **错误处理**:提供了处理iCloud相关错误的最佳实践。 ### 八、OpenGLES 2.0与GLKit基础(Chapter 8: Beginning OpenGLES 2.0 with GLKit) - **OpenGL ES概述**:介绍了OpenGL ES 2.0的基本概念及其在iOS中的应用。 - **GLKit框架**:解释了GLKit框架的功能及如何使用它简化OpenGL ES编程。 - **绘制基本图形**:演示了如何使用OpenGL ES 2.0和GLKit来绘制简单的图形。 ### 九、中级OpenGLES 2.0与GLKit(Chapter 9: Intermediate OpenGLES 2.0 with GLKit) - **纹理映射**:介绍了如何为模型添加纹理,以提高其真实感。 - **光照效果**:演示了如何模拟不同的光照条件,以增强视觉效果。 - **高级渲染技术**:探讨了阴影、反射等高级渲染技术的实现方法。 ### 十、UIKit定制化基础(Chapter 10: Beginning UIKit Customization) - **UIKit框架**:概述了UIKit框架的基本结构及其在iOS开发中的作用。 - **控件定制**:讲解了如何自定义标准UIKit控件的外观和行为。 - **新组件创建**:演示了如何从头开始创建新的UIKit组件。 ### 十一、中级UIKit定制化(Chapter 11: Intermediate UIKit Customization) - **动画效果**:介绍了如何为UIKit控件添加动画效果,以增强用户体验。 - **响应式设计**:讲解了如何使界面在不同尺寸的屏幕上都能良好显示。 - **多触摸支持**:探讨了如何实现多点触控功能,提高用户交互性。 ### 十二、Twitter集成基础(Chapter 12: Beginning Twitter) - **Twitter API概览**:介绍了Twitter API的基础知识及其在iOS应用中的应用场景。 - **用户授权流程**:详细说明了如何实现Twitter用户的授权过程。 - **发送推文**:演示了如何使用Twitter API发送推文。 ### 十三、中级Twitter集成(Chapter 13: Intermediate Twitter) - **高级API功能**:介绍了Twitter API的高级功能,如获取用户信息和搜索推文。 - **数据解析**:讲解了如何解析从Twitter API返回的数据。 - **错误处理**:提供了处理Twitter API调用中可能出现错误的方法。 以上只是本书中部分章节的概括介绍。通过阅读这些章节,开发者可以系统地学习iOS 5开发的核心技术和最佳实践,从而构建出高质量的应用程序。每章都包含了丰富的示例代码和实际案例,帮助读者更好地理解和掌握所学知识。
- rosecai20302013-04-21英文版的。 网络上好多呢。 5分不值啊。 英文差的 伤不起啊!!!
- innerpeacer2013-03-27一群大神编写的书,非常实用
- 粉丝: 1
- 资源: 10
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助